Key Responsibilities:
  • Design, supervise, and manage site investigations, including cost estimation and procurement of subcontractor services.
  • Perform geotechnical design with a focus on slope stability, settlement, retaining structures, and reinforced earth. Oversee earthworks specification, design, and supervision.
  • Prepare interpretative reports for geotechnical and related environmental projects.
  • Provide line management and mentoring to junior technical staff.
  • Prepare Health & Safety documentation and assist in the collation of project-related health and safety information.
  • Attend site meetings, liaise with clients, and act as a primary contact for project-related communications.
 
Qualifications / Experience / Skills:
  • A degree in one of the Earth Sciences.
  • At least 4 years of relevant experience, including a minimum of 2 years in both geo-environmental fieldwork and geotechnical design/assessment (covering slope stability, settlement, retaining structures, earthworks, and reinforced earth).
  • Willingness to work outdoors in various weather conditions and occasionally away from home or during unsociable hours.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ills.
  • Strong interpersonal and team-working skills, fostering good relationships across all levels of the organization, clients, and contractors.
  • Ability to adapt to rapidly changing circumstances and client requests, with a proactive and positive approach.
  • Proficiency in logging soil and rock according to current British Standards.
  • Understanding of relevant UK regulatory guidance.
  • Experience with software such as Holebase, CAD, QGIS, Slide, and Geo5 is an advantage (training will be provided if necessary).
  • First Aid, Asbestos Awareness, and CSCS qualifications are beneficial (training available).
  • Membership in the Geological Society (or a similar organization) with consideration for becoming Chartered.
  • A full UK Driving License (Category B manual gears) is essential.
